The Roots è un gruppo hip hop statunitense formatosi a Filadelfia nel 1987. Il nucleo fondante del gruppo è composto dal rapper Black Thought e dal batterista e produttore Questlove, che hanno collaborato con diversi musicisti, cantanti ed MCs nel corso degli anni. Considerati uno dei gruppi più influenti della scena hip hop contemporanea, The Roots sono noti per la loro musica caratterizzata da un sound jazzistico e funk, spesso arricchito da arrangiamenti complessi e improvvisazioni dal vivo. Oltre alla produzione musicale, il gruppo si è distinto anche per le sue performance live energiche e coinvolgenti. Dal 2014, The Roots ricoprono il ruolo di house band nel programma televisivo "The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on". Tra i brani più rappresentativi del loro repertorio figurano "You Got Me", "The Seed (2.0)" e "Mellow My Mind".
La radio è morta? No. Ma non è più il cancello d'ingresso. Negli ultimi anni qualcosa è cambiato ? radicalmente. Canzoni sconosciute esplodono in pochi giorni. Artisti senza contratto discografico raccolgono milioni di stream. E le radio? Arrivano dopo, non prima. Il pubblico ha preso il controllo. Il potere dei video brevi: 15 secondi che cambiano tutto TikTok ha trasformato le regole del gioco musicale. Una melodia che dura meno di venti secondi può diventare il suono di un'intera estate. Nel 2023, oltre il 70% delle canzoni entrate nella Billboard Hot 100 aveva avuto un'origine virale su piattaforme social prima di ricevere attenzione radiofonica.
